The Gp2x - Out Of Curiosity


I have two issues with my GP2X. The first is that it doesn't have built-in lithium batteries that will charge when plugged in. I've been using two sets of rechargeables (one set charges while the other is in the device), but constantly swapping them is annoying. The rest of my devices (smartphone, PSP, PocketPC, N-gage :blink: ) just charge when I plug 'em in, which fits my lifestyle better.

My only other grievance is with the shoulder buttons. They require noticeably more pressure and leverage than others I've used (Xbox controller, PSP), so I don't use them as much. It's too bad, because it was a great design feature to include them.

Otherwise, I love everything else about the controls, display, weight, size, etc.! And unlike some folks, the joystick controller has never bothered me.

The biggest positive for the device is the strong community support. If you like emulators, you really can't go wrong with the GP2X. And there's a pretty good homebrew selection, too! So you end up paying for the hardware, and getting insane amounts of software for free.
